Current Pinch Effect during Solar Flare Eruptions

Haili Li,
Hongfei Liang,
Xinping Zhou
et al.

Abstract: Based on the vector magnetograms obtained from the SDO/HMI, we calculate the line-of-sight current density distribution of the active region on 2017 September 6, using the integral form of Ampere's law. Comparing the distribution of the current density and the observed flare, we find that: Firstly, the changing trend of the total current density of the active region was consistent with the change of the X-ray flux of the X9.3 flare.
